Bankruptcy, Republicans, and Democrats

According to the clerk’s office of the Eastern District of Virginia….recent years have seen a resurgence, with 5,448 Chapter 7 bankruptcies already finalized this year.

This post discusses how bankruptcy reform came to pass in 2005 in D.C. And it mentions that while bankruptcy rates intially fell after BAPCPA’s enactment in 2005….
